Westbrook Brewing Company (Mt. Pleasant, SC) just released Raver’s Extra Ripe Old Ale. The beer is an old ale, aged 50% bourbon barrels, 25% in red wine barrels, and 25% brandy barrels.

Modern Times Beer (San Diego, CA) is gearing up for a sour beer release on December 11th, 2014. This will be the brewery’s first public release.
